Output 4eec1a7302ab84c8f9ccbd4bfc19a7da457626a4155d01fd20fc96786725ab8e:12

value
2037652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3e1b38f3b0342701d08ab19f343af3a820ed14 OP_EQUAL
address
3G2SQtHptcrseVa6YbU97yiAovBWz38NCs
transaction
4eec1a7302ab84c8f9ccbd4bfc19a7da457626a4155d01fd20fc96786725ab8e
spent
true